Ever wonder where your food REALLY comes from? Join Taaka Awori and her mother, Dr. Thelma Awori, a renowned feminist, development expert, and former UN Assistant Secretary General in this captivating episode of Leadership in Africa Redefined.

Learn how African women produce 70% of the continent’s food, yet still face major barriers to land ownership and leadership. Through powerful stories and hard truths, Dr. Thelma Awori highlights the power of collective action and leadership in driving change. But this conversation goes beyond food and leadership. It’s also a deeply personal reflection on Dr. Thelma’s influence on Taaka’s own leadership journey, 
And with one unforgettable challenge, “Why bargain with market women when you don’t bargain at the supermarket?” - this episode invites you to rethink everyday choices through a lens of dignity and equity.
